GC–MS analysis and antibacterial activities of Moringa oleifera leaf extracts on selected clinical bacterial isolates

Abstract: Background Man has a long history of utilizing herbal preparations to treat infections. Therefore, this study aimed to investigate the quantitative phytochemical components, gas chromatography–mass spectrometry analysis, and the antibacterial properties of the aqueous and ethanol leaf extracts of Moringa oleifera on some clinical bacterial isolates. “…A GC–MS study on Moringa oleifera leaf extracts by Enerijiofi et al . (2021) revealed the presence of 11 compounds, including 2‐octenoic acid, hexadecanoic acid, pentadecanoic acid, tetradecanoic acid, 6‐octadecenoic acid, 5‐nonanol‐dibutylcarbinol, 1‐hydroxyl‐2,2,6,6‐tetramethyl‐3‐(4‐nitroso‐1‐piperazinylmethyl)—piperidine‐4‐one, 1,2‐benzene dicarboxylic, 5‐hydroxyl‐2‐(hydroxylmethyl)‐4H‐pyran‐4‐one, 1,2‐epoxyhexadecane (oxirane) and 11‐bromoundecanoic acid.…”
